It's Halloween is a 1977 picture book written by American author Jack Prelutsky and illustrated by Marylin Hafner. [1] It is a collection of children's poems with a Halloween theme, and is one of Prelutsky's four holiday-themed books for beginning readers. [2] The book was republished in October 2002 as Halloween Countdown, with pictures by American author and illustrator Dan Yaccarino. [3]
The edition published by Scholastic Book Services (a division of Scholastic Inc.) omits one poem titled "Trick...". As a result, the subsequent poem "...or Treat" was retitled as simply "Treat". [4] The Scholastic edition also omits several pages and illustrations.
